Through an article at the Spanish newspaper El Pais, the radical part of Podemos in Spain declares full support to the Popular Unity, the new political formation in Greece that came from the split of SYRIZA. It is worth to note that its executives criticize the stance of Podemos leader, Pablo Iglesias, to support Alexis Tsipras, even after his surrender to the representatives of the European Financial Dictatorship.

Key parts from the Iskra.gr website which reflects Popular Unity positions:

The anti-capitalist Left, the party that has been self-dissolved to join Podemos in which the leading Andalusian Teresa Rodríguez and MEP Miguel Urbán participate, is aligned with the radicals that left SYRIZA, opposing Alexis Tsipras and the Podemos leadership which insists on the unconditional support of the Greek prime minister. The spokesman of the anti-capitalist Left, Raúl Camargo, MP with Podemos in the Madrid Parliament , addressed a call on Saturday in the last session of the summer university to 'defend the Popular Unity, the party that was cut off from SYRIZA' against Tsipras who ended claiming that 'no se puede' (it's not possible). This stream of Podemos calls for return to an electoral program as that of the European elections, more democracy in the party and considers that it is clear that 'by no means will form a coalition with PSOE' (Social Democrats).

It seems that SYRIZA's split sends turbulence waves to the European Left. There are also some signals from Germany and Die Linke, according to which, there is a debate between top party members on whether it is useful for the Left to insist on the euro-currency unconditionally.

Apparently, the moderate of the European Left still believe that there is a chance for a significant change in Europe through the transformation of the political power balance inside the euro-prison. One the other hand, the radicals obviously don't believe in euro "at any cost", and set as absolute priority the termination of the neoliberal catastrophic policies in Europe.
